Abstract

A detailed morphological description of the external structures of robber flies of the genus Polysarca Schiner, 1866 and a comparison of the male genitalia of all the species are given for the first time. A key to the species is compiled based on new characters of the male genitalia. Lectotype of P. gussakovskiji is designated. New information on the distribution of the species, detailed analysis of their ranges, and distribution maps in the Tethys area are provided.
